Abstract

This research aims to determine the relationship between learning motivation and student academic achievement at MTs EXPGA. This research uses a quantitative approach with a correlational design. The sample used was 292 students, with an average student academic achievement score of 92. Data was collected using a questionnaire to measure learning motivation and academic value data obtained from student report cards. Data analysis was carried out using the Pearson correlation test to determine whether there was a significant relationship between learning motivation and academic achievement. The research results show that there is a significant positive relationship between learning motivation and student academic achievement at MTs Ex PGA, which shows that the higher the learning motivation, the better the academic achievement achieved. This research provides evidence that learning motivation plays an important role in determining students' academic success.
